Enlarging Growth of the Mental Region in a 48-Year-old Man.
Oral surgery, oral medicine, oral pathology and oral radiology(2018)
摘要
A 48-year-old man was referred to the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ery Clinic at the London Health Sciences Centre for a mass on the right chin (Figure 1). The mass had initially appeared 2 years before presentation, without preceding trauma. There was no reported pain, numbness, or discoloration of the overlying skin or oral mucosa associated with the lesion. Over the preceding 6 months, an interval increase in size was noted, with fluctuations in size reported to occur with anxiety and blood pressure elevation. The patient's past medical history was noncontributory, and he was a nonsmoker.
